Collection of sustainable tourism certifications in the Mediterranean: the web platform created by the project LABELSCAPE

In order to support tourism destinations in obtaining the sustainable certification, project LABELSCAPE created a web platform with Collection of sustainable tourism certifications in the Mediterranean, available at this link: https://sustainablelabels.eu. In collection you can find certification and labels which: certify destinations, parks and/or beaches, follow UN Sustainable Development Goals

Commission welcomes the adoption of €373 billion Cohesion policy legislative package 2021-2027

European Commission Press release Brussels, 25 Jun 2021 The European Commission welcomes the adoption by the European Parliament of the political agreements on the Cohesion policy legislative package 2021-2027 of €373 billion and its signature by both co-legislators. Powered by WPeMatico
